The Under One Moon Arts Festival taking place at Tico Time River Resort on April 25-26, 2026 will bridge the gaps between ages, art forms, and communities in Durango music, dance, and theater performances as well visual arts exhibitions during our fundraising festival. This festival will serve as a fundraising event supporting youth access to the arts! We will be donating our proceeds to two organizations, The Genesis Inspiration Foundation- a nonprofit organization founded in 2018 with a mission to connect youth to the transformative power of the arts- as well as Durango Friends of the Arts- an all-volunteer organization raising funds for projects and programs whose goals provide educational and cultural benefits to the people of the greater Durango area. We will connect student artists from a range of art institutions locally including Stillwater Music, iamMusic, Prickly pear dance, Durango Dance, and Bella Dance with local and regional performing artists in an effort to join organizations and art forms in the area. This celebration will not only bring Durango citizens together, but will also provide a platform to help under-resourced youth access the arts both locally and in our nation. One hundred percent of the proceeds will be divided between the two organizations and donated!

The BREWS FOR RESCUES BEER FEST takes place from noon until 4 on Saturday, April 25th, at the Archuleta County Fairgrounds. the event will include music, food trucks, an artisan goods market, and over 40 craft beers, ciders and more. All proceeds support Rugby’s Rescue House, a nonprofit dedicated to rescuing and rehoming dogs and cats from Native American reservations. Pagosafun.com has more information.

The 2026 Durango Wine Experience takes place April 24th and 25th at multiple locations.Featuring hundreds of wines, beers, spirits, and mocktails from Colorado and beyond.Earlybird pricing ends December 31st.Details are at durangowine.com.
This event also presents the Durango Restaurant Showcase, where top local chefs serve dishes crafted to pair perfectly with every pour.
April 24 kicks off with the Friday Walkabout in Downtown Durango. Wander between Main Ave. and 2nd Ave. to enjoy tastings at 10 local businesses, including galleries, boutiques, chocolate shops, and more.
April 25 features the Grand Tasting in Buckley Park, the ultimate celebration of wine, beer, spirits, mocktails, and amazing food—all in the heart of Downtown Durango.
